AMD wins the 2014 Smart Commute “Employer of the Year” award

Eight days after Dr. Lisa Su took over as the AMD CEO, she announced the third quarter results and Wall Street was unhappy. AMD explained they would reduce the number of employees by 7% as it restructured and attempted to enter markets not dominated by Intel.

One month later, AMD is able to accept the 2014 Smart Commute “Employer of the Year” award for the York Region. Last year’s winner was PowerStream.

AMD started the Go Green Commuter program in 2007. According to an internal survey, 4 out of 10 employees use clean transportation to arrive to work.

About AMD

AMD has global operations in 31 countries, across more than 50 locations, including more than a dozen R&D facilities, nearly two dozen international sales offices and assembly/test manufacturing facilities in Asia.
